Lazio started its Serie A campaign with a 1-0 victory over Bologna on August 24, 2026, at the Renato Dall’Ara. Davide Frattesi emerged as the decisive player, scoring shortly after being substituted in the second half. The match showcased limited chances for both teams, but Lazio's defense, led by goalkeeper Christos Mandas, managed to maintain a clean sheet against Bologna's attempts. This win comes just eight days after Lazio's early exit from the Coppa Italia, marking a positive turnaround for the squad.
